EV fostering remains to slow down
Very early adopters all have one, however obtaining the typical American to sell their gas-powered vehicles and SUVs for an electrical one has actually been a difficulty for almost every carmaker. Whether it’s array stress and anxiety or the price, EVs are being overlooked for crossbreeds and traditional automobiles, indicating bargains for customers going to take that jump.
Ed Kim, head of state and principal expert at AutoPacific, changed his EV market share in the united state to 9.7%, a decline from his previous projection of 10.3% for 2025.
” EV fostering will certainly expand however at a much slower price,” he informed ABC Information. “Car manufacturers are writing off EVs.”
Whether the Trump management reroutes government financing far from constructing out the billing network is a big variable, Kim kept in mind, however there’s a silver lining for customers: lots of brand-new designs will certainly work with the NACS [North American Charging Standard] plug, which Tesla spearheaded. Proprietors of non-Teslas will certainly after that have the ability to gain from Tesla’s practical and considerable billing framework.
” Among the obstacles to EV fostering is billing. It’s made complex for individuals,” claimed Kim. “You need to recognize the distinction in between L2 and L3 charging. When you have an EV, it’s not as straightforward as simply connecting it in.”
He took place, “With car manufacturers changing their ports with NACS, it’s a large action for streamlining billing and will certainly assist make billing less complex for the customer.”
Ivan Drury, supervisor of understandings at Edmunds, claimed if Trump gets rid of the government tax obligation credit ratings on EVs, there is one firm that will greatly profit: Tesla.
” Tesla is the brand name individuals connect with EVs. Every person understands it and individuals trust fund Tesla for electrification,” he claimed.
0% funding returns
It’s been truly hard to rack up a bargain on brand-new autos and vehicles in the last couple of years. With manufacturing and producing back to pre-pandemic degrees, suppliers aspire to minimize excess supply and 0% funding offers are making a return.
” The automobile market is quite saturated,” Tony Quiroga, editor-in-chief of Automobile and Chauffeur, informed ABC Information. “Suppliers wish to fulfill their sales targets and 0% funding is back amongst lots of brand names.”
One of the most engaging 0% funding offers might get on EVs, however it’s feasible to discover them on conventional Kias, Jeeps and Mazdas, claimed Quiroga.
” Manufacturing will certainly go beyond need for some time, which produces offers for customers,” Quiroga kept in mind. “Following year will certainly be an excellent year for automobile sales. Makers appear encouraged to relocate the steel.”
Drury claimed bench might still be high for some customers to grab that 0% offer. That need to not hinder those searching for a brand-new lorry though; car manufacturers throughout the board are giving considerable discount rates to bring in customers.
” There are extra renting chances currently than versus a couple of years back,” he informed ABC Information, including that new EVs are resting on great deals despite having hefty rewards from car manufacturers. If you’re seriously disputing obtaining an EV, currently is the moment, Drury suggested.
” There is no advantage to possibly awaiting points to worsen,” he claimed.
Sports autos are still sought after
Sports autos and supercars are plainly not disappearing. As a matter of fact, conventional cars marques like Bugatti, Aston Martin, McLaren and Lamborghini revealed effective, jaw-dropping automobiles to please the fanatic group in 2024. Electric cars control the 0 to 60 miles per hour world, so car manufacturers are concentrating currently on what makes interior burning engines so unique, Quiroga claimed. And anticipate even more of these renowned autos in 2025.
” The Lamborghini Temerario accentuates the positives of what fanatics like concerning burning engines,” Quiroga claimed. “The brand-new ZR1 has a turbocharged Z06 engine. The Bugatti [Tourbillon] offers clients what they wish to experience: noise, really feel and velocity.”
Drury claimed the upcoming Honda Overture fills up a significant void in the cars market.
” The cost effective car market is experiencing participants and while all the guidelines have actually altered when it involves what powers a cars … there is little question that having new members in this section will certainly a minimum of obtain heads to transform and some hearts to defeat,” he claimed. “It could not be a halo automobile or the highest degree of efficiency for the buck, however Overture does load deep space that Civic and Accord Sports car left years back.”
There are a couple of electrical cars coming that fanatics will certainly wish to take note of, claimed Quiroga, such as the Battery Charger Daytona Scat Load. “I am really delighted concerning that,” he claimed.
Tariffs might not quit Chinese EVs from involving the United States
China has actually been a warm subject in the sector and an emphasis of the Biden management. Kim claimed the choice by Japanese car manufacturers Honda and Nissan to combine pressures was likely a critical transfer to maintain China away.
” China lags all this combination and toning up to be an enormous giant,” Kim claimed. “This is taking place quicker than lots of idea.”
Chinese firms generate even more autos than any type of various other nation worldwide and control EV battery innovation, he kept in mind.
” The globe is horrified by China and tolls will just reduce it down a little bit … combination can significantly minimize expenses and car manufacturers can share sources needed to fight the Chinese, that have enormous price and technology benefits,” claimed Kim, including, “It might obtain unsightly for existing car manufacturers.”
Quiroga indicated the top quality electrics the Chinese are constructing, consisting of autos that can apparently obtain greater than 600 miles of array in an issue of mins.
” Simply the large quantity of manufacturing … there’s been this surge by Chinese car manufacturers,” he claimed. “They appear identified to get into the united state market.”
Kim said that Trump’s recommended tolls might not quit Chinese-made EVs from being offered in the united state Furthermore, China is incoming a social networks project to enlighten Americans concerning their automobiles.
” Chinese car manufacturers are increase initiatives on social media sites that are targeted to Americans. They’re paying influencers from right here to take a trip to China, drive their autos and place throughout TikTok,” he claimed. “These firms are proactively constructing recognition in the united state … the autos will certainly be right here earlier than we believe.”
Drury claimed the toll talk and risks from Trump is simply that– talk– and does not expect the following management to follow up on its project assures.
” The language is most likely much tougher than the truth,” he claimed. “The implications for the total economic climate are as well huge. Tariffs are an excellent negotiating chip, however in regards to them totally being executed, I question it.”
